c8d2ca3eb4af0827080c706bb18d768bf2865000.svn-base 9.2 KB


  1. package org.jeecg.modules.demo.hzz.shjsgc.xcjgjl.entity;
  2. import java.io.Serializable;
  3. import java.io.UnsupportedEncodingException;
  4. import java.util.Date;
  5. import java.math.BigDecimal;
  6. import com.baomidou.mybatisplus.annotation.IdType;
  7. import com.baomidou.mybatisplus.annotation.TableId;
  8. import com.baomidou.mybatisplus.annotation.TableName;
  9. import lombok.Data;
  10. import com.fasterxml.jackson.annotation.JsonFormat;
  11. import org.springframework.format.annotation.DateTimeFormat;
  12. import org.jeecgframework.poi.excel.annotation.Excel;
  13. import org.jeecg.common.aspect.annotation.Dict;
  14. import io.swagger.annotations.ApiModel;
  15. import io.swagger.annotations.ApiModelProperty;
  16. import lombok.EqualsAndHashCode;
  17. import lombok.experimental.Accessors;
  18. /**
  19. * @Description: 现场监管记录
  20. * @Author: jeecg-boot
  21. * @Date: 2022-01-08
  22. * @Version: V1.0
  23. */
  24. @Data
  25. @TableName("rm_xcjgjl")
  26. @Accessors(chain = true)
  27. @EqualsAndHashCode(callSuper = false)
  28. @ApiModel(value="rm_xcjgjl对象", description="现场监管记录")
  29. public class RmXcjgjl implements Serializable {
  30. private static final long serialVersionUID = 1L;
  31. /**主键*/
  32. @TableId(type = IdType.ASSIGN_ID)
  33. @ApiModelProperty(value = "主键")
  34. private java.lang.String id;
  35. /**创建人*/
  36. @ApiModelProperty(value = "创建人")
  37. private java.lang.String createBy;
  38. /**创建日期*/
  39. @JsonFormat(timezone = "GMT+8",pattern = "yyyy-MM-dd HH:mm:ss")
  40. @DateTimeFormat(pattern="yyyy-MM-dd HH:mm:ss")
  41. @ApiModelProperty(value = "创建日期")
  42. private java.util.Date createTime;
  43. /**更新人*/
  44. @ApiModelProperty(value = "更新人")
  45. private java.lang.String updateBy;
  46. /**更新日期*/
  47. @JsonFormat(timezone = "GMT+8",pattern = "yyyy-MM-dd HH:mm:ss")
  48. @DateTimeFormat(pattern="yyyy-MM-dd HH:mm:ss")
  49. @ApiModelProperty(value = "更新日期")
  50. private java.util.Date updateTime;
  51. /**所属部门*/
  52. @ApiModelProperty(value = "所属部门")
  53. private java.lang.String sysOrgCode;
  54. /**建设项目名称*/
  55. @Excel(name = "建设项目名称", width = 15)
  56. @ApiModelProperty(value = "建设项目名称")
  57. private java.lang.String jsxmmc;
  58. @Excel(name = "建设项目ID", width = 15)
  59. @ApiModelProperty(value = "建设项目ID")
  60. private java.lang.String jsxmid;
  61. /**业主单位名称*/
  62. @Excel(name = "业主单位名称", width = 15)
  63. @ApiModelProperty(value = "业主单位名称")
  64. private java.lang.String yzdwmc;
  65. /**建设项目所在地*/
  66. @Excel(name = "建设项目所在地", width = 15)
  67. @ApiModelProperty(value = "建设项目所在地")
  68. private java.lang.String jsxmszd;
  69. /**建设项目所在河道*/
  70. @Excel(name = "建设项目所在河道", width = 15)
  71. @ApiModelProperty(value = "建设项目所在河道")
  72. private java.lang.String jsxmszhd;
  73. /**开工日期*/
  74. @Excel(name = "开工日期", width = 15, format = "yyyy-MM-dd")
  75. @JsonFormat(timezone = "GMT+8",pattern = "yyyy-MM-dd")
  76. @DateTimeFormat(pattern="yyyy-MM-dd")
  77. @ApiModelProperty(value = "开工日期")
  78. private java.util.Date kgrq;
  79. /**竣工日期*/
  80. @Excel(name = "竣工日期", width = 15, format = "yyyy-MM-dd")
  81. @JsonFormat(timezone = "GMT+8",pattern = "yyyy-MM-dd")
  82. @DateTimeFormat(pattern="yyyy-MM-dd")
  83. @ApiModelProperty(value = "竣工日期")
  84. private java.util.Date jgrq;
  85. /**建设情况*/
  86. @Excel(name = "建设情况", width = 15, dicCode = "gcjsqk")
  87. @Dict(dicCode = "gcjsqk")
  88. @ApiModelProperty(value = "建设情况")
  89. private java.lang.String jsqk;
  90. /**是否需要编制*/
  91. @Excel(name = "是否需要编制", width = 15, dicCode = "yn")
  92. @Dict(dicCode = "yn")
  93. @ApiModelProperty(value = "是否需要编制")
  94. private java.lang.String sfxybz;
  95. /**是否编制*/
  96. @Excel(name = "是否编制", width = 15, dicCode = "yn")
  97. @Dict(dicCode = "yn")
  98. @ApiModelProperty(value = "是否编制")
  99. private java.lang.String sfbz;
  100. /**是否评审*/
  101. @Excel(name = "是否评审", width = 15, dicCode = "yn")
  102. @Dict(dicCode = "yn")
  103. @ApiModelProperty(value = "是否评审")
  104. private java.lang.String sfps;
  105. /**审批机关*/
  106. @Excel(name = "审批机关", width = 15)
  107. @ApiModelProperty(value = "审批机关")
  108. private java.lang.String spjg;
  109. /**审批文号*/
  110. @Excel(name = "审批文号", width = 15)
  111. @ApiModelProperty(value = "审批文号")
  112. private java.lang.String spwh;
  113. /**是否审核*/
  114. @Excel(name = "是否审核", width = 15, dicCode = "yn")
  115. @Dict(dicCode = "yn")
  116. @ApiModelProperty(value = "是否审核")
  117. private java.lang.String sfsh;
  118. /**施工审核机关、文件、时间*/
  119. @Excel(name = "施工审核机关、文件、时间", width = 15)
  120. @ApiModelProperty(value = "施工审核机关、文件、时间")
  121. private java.lang.String sgshjgwjsj;
  122. /**施工单位*/
  123. @Excel(name = "施工单位", width = 15)
  124. @ApiModelProperty(value = "施工单位")
  125. private java.lang.String sgdw;
  126. /**监管单位*/
  127. @Excel(name = "监管单位", width = 15)
  128. @ApiModelProperty(value = "监管单位")
  129. private java.lang.String jgdw;
  130. /**施工现场是否符合要求*/
  131. @Excel(name = "施工现场是否符合要求", width = 15, dicCode = "yn")
  132. @Dict(dicCode = "yn")
  133. @ApiModelProperty(value = "施工现场是否符合要求")
  134. private java.lang.String sgxcsffhyq;
  135. /**施工结束是否恢复河道原状*/
  136. @Excel(name = "施工结束是否恢复河道原状", width = 15, dicCode = "yn")
  137. @Dict(dicCode = "yn")
  138. @ApiModelProperty(value = "施工结束是否恢复河道原状")
  139. private java.lang.String sgjssfhfhdyz;
  140. /**是否跨汛施工*/
  141. @Excel(name = "是否跨汛施工", width = 15, dicCode = "yn")
  142. @Dict(dicCode = "yn")
  143. @ApiModelProperty(value = "是否跨汛施工")
  144. private java.lang.String sfkxsg;
  145. /**度汛方案是否编制*/
  146. @Excel(name = "度汛方案是否编制", width = 15, dicCode = "yn")
  147. @Dict(dicCode = "yn")
  148. @ApiModelProperty(value = "度汛方案是否编制")
  149. private java.lang.String dxfasfbz;
  150. /**责任制是否落实*/
  151. @Excel(name = "责任制是否落实", width = 15, dicCode = "yn")
  152. @Dict(dicCode = "yn")
  153. @ApiModelProperty(value = "责任制是否落实")
  154. private java.lang.String zrzsfls;
  155. /**人员、物资是否落实*/
  156. @Excel(name = "人员、物资是否落实", width = 15, dicCode = "yn")
  157. @Dict(dicCode = "yn")
  158. @ApiModelProperty(value = "人员、物资是否落实")
  159. private java.lang.String rywzsfls;
  160. /**是否要求*/
  161. @Excel(name = "是否要求", width = 15, dicCode = "yn")
  162. @Dict(dicCode = "yn")
  163. @ApiModelProperty(value = "是否要求")
  164. private java.lang.String sfyq;
  165. /**按要求完成情况*/
  166. @Excel(name = "按要求完成情况", width = 15, dicCode = "ayqwcqk")
  167. @Dict(dicCode = "ayqwcqk")
  168. @ApiModelProperty(value = "按要求完成情况")
  169. private java.lang.String ayqwcqk;
  170. /**是否验收*/
  171. @Excel(name = "是否验收", width = 15, dicCode = "yn")
  172. @Dict(dicCode = "yn")
  173. @ApiModelProperty(value = "是否验收")
  174. private java.lang.String sfys;
  175. /**建设项目是否已竣工验收*/
  176. @Excel(name = "建设项目是否已竣工验收", width = 15, dicCode = "yn")
  177. @Dict(dicCode = "yn")
  178. @ApiModelProperty(value = "建设项目是否已竣工验收")
  179. private java.lang.String jsxmsfyjgys;
  180. /**是否参加建设项目竣工验收*/
  181. @Excel(name = "是否参加建设项目竣工验收", width = 15, dicCode = "yn")
  182. @Dict(dicCode = "yn")
  183. @ApiModelProperty(value = "是否参加建设项目竣工验收")
  184. private java.lang.String sfcjjsxmjgys;
  185. /**有关资料是否报备*/
  186. @Excel(name = "有关资料是否报备", width = 15, dicCode = "yn")
  187. @Dict(dicCode = "yn")
  188. @ApiModelProperty(value = "有关资料是否报备")
  189. private java.lang.String ygzlsfbb;
  190. /**有关资料是否报备*/
  191. @Excel(name = "审批情况", width = 15, dicCode = "spzt")
  192. @Dict(dicCode = "spzt")
  193. @ApiModelProperty(value = "审批情况")
  194. private java.lang.String spqk;
  195. /**存在问题及处理情况*/
  196. @Excel(name = "存在问题及处理情况", width = 15)
  197. @ApiModelProperty(value = "存在问题及处理情况")
  198. private java.lang.String czwtjclqk;
  199. /**相关图件*/
  200. @Excel(name = "相关图件", width = 15)
  201. @ApiModelProperty(value = "相关图件")
  202. private java.lang.String xgtj;
  203. /**视频上传*/
  204. // @Excel(name = "视频上传", width = 15)
  205. @ApiModelProperty(value = "视频上传")
  206. private java.lang.String wbfa;
  207. /**图形信息*/
  208. @ApiModelProperty(value = "geoinfo")
  209. private java.lang.String geoinfo;
  210. /**数据来源*/
  211. @Dict(dicCode = "laiyuan")
  212. @ApiModelProperty(value = "数据来源")
  213. private java.lang.String sjly;
  214. /**检查名称*/
  215. @Excel(name = "检查名称", width = 15)
  216. @ApiModelProperty(value = "检查名称")
  217. private java.lang.String jcmc;
  218. /**监管负责人*/
  219. @Excel(name = "监管负责人", width = 15)
  220. @ApiModelProperty(value = "监管负责人")
  221. private java.lang.String jgfzr;
  222. /**横坐标*/
  223. @Excel(name = "横坐标", width = 15)
  224. @ApiModelProperty(value = "横坐标")
  225. private java.lang.String hzb;
  226. /**纵坐标*/
  227. @Excel(name = "纵坐标", width = 15)
  228. @ApiModelProperty(value = "纵坐标")
  229. private java.lang.String zzb;
  230. /**检查时间*/
  231. @Excel(name = "检查时间", width = 15, format = "yyyy-MM-dd")
  232. @JsonFormat(timezone = "GMT+8",pattern = "yyyy-MM-dd")
  233. @DateTimeFormat(pattern="yyyy-MM-dd")
  234. @ApiModelProperty(value = "检查时间")
  235. private java.util.Date jcsj;
  236. }